被分类学关系掩盖的分类器效应:通过相似性判断任务镜头

概括
中国人表现出隐性分类器效应,对对象属性的敏感度更高,但不依赖分类器关系来感知对象.

背景情况:
- 分类器,名词引用跟踪器,在语义上与头名词属性联系在一起.
- 之前的研究表明"分类器效应",即分类器语言的使用者对动态性,形状和功能等参数具有更高的敏感性.
研究的目的:
- 通过精细的相似性判断任务,研究中文发言者的分类器效应.
- 为了比较中文和英语发言人的对分类学,主题,分类器和填充物对的敏感性.
主要方法:
- 对讲汉语 (N=41) 和英语 (N=41) 的人进行了细粒度相似性判断任务.
- 参与者根据四个条件的语义相关性对对象进行评分:分类学,主题学,分类器和填充器.
- 对于每个对条件,记录了响应时间.
主要成果:
- 中国语说者对分类学对的评价明显低于英语说者,这表明概念突出性的差异.
- 动态性成为分类学对中最突出的特征,其次是功能和形状.
- 两组都优先考虑了主题对,其次是分类学,分类器和填料对.
- 在所有对条件中,讲汉语的人表现出更长的响应时间.
结论:
- 研究结果表明,在中国人中,隐含的分类器效应会影响对象的感知.
- 然而,这项研究表明,分类器关系并不是中国人对物体知觉的主要驱动因素.
- 突出了概念突出性的差异,特别是关于动态,功能和形状的差异.
